Library privileges for off campus students.

Students living off campus, whether in Blanding or Salt Lake City, have access to a variety of electronic information resources and library services. A set of policies based on a cooperative effort among libraries at institutions of higher education was developed to better serve students. In general, they're designed to make life easier for you. UALC Privileges.
The Utah Academic Library Consortium (UALC), a consortium of libraries representing institutions of higher education within the state, offers you, among other things, reciprocal borrowing and return of materials privileges.
